Prospect; Carleton Graves, 66, of 16 Maple Dr., died Wed., Dec. 24, 2003 at Beacon Brook Health Center after a short encounter with cancer. Mr. Graves was born Oct. 14, 1937 in New Haven a son of the late Charles and Helen Hughes Graves. He lived most of his life in the Westville section of New Haven and was a graduate of Hillhouse High School. He worked for over 25 years at Dworkin Chevorlet until his retirement. Carl served six years in the U.S. Army Reserves. Besides his longtime companion, Annette, he leaves a daughter, Michele and granddaughter, Morgan of Roswell, GA, a sister, Virginia Connell and 24 n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by a brother, Charles Carleton Graves. A graveside service will be held at Grove Street Cemetery on Wednesday, December 31, 2003 at 10:30 a.m. Contributions may be sent to Waterbury VNA Hospice Home Care, 58 Brookside Rd., Waterbury, CT 06708.
